https://www.avient.com/news/new-non-pfas-mold-release-additive-avient-high-temperature-polymers-help-enhance-manufacturing-efficiency
Colorant Chromatics™ Evoluscend™ non-PFAS mold release additive for high-temperature polymers integrates directly into plastic materials and migrates to the surface during molding to facilitate a smooth demolding experience.
This process can help reduce cycle times and boost productivity by reducing demolding times and protecting the mold and the manufactured plastic parts while utilizing an alternative to PFAS-based additives.
Limiting Damage: By acting as a lubricant, Evoluscend™ additive can help limit mold damage, supporting the longevity and quality of the mold and the plastic products

https://www.avient.com/products/long-fiber-technology/benefits-long-fiber-reinforced-thermoplastic-composites
The higher toughness of long fiber composites makes them among the most durable of injection molding plastic materials with structural characteristics.
As a general rule, load forces for plastic articles should be no more than half of the material’s maximum load capability to prevent creep from occurring.
Plastics also require fewer finishing operations than other materials and their increased design freedom can reduce component count eliminating assembly steps.
